The Drawing in Question.

There’s a couple of things I really like about this drawing. Firstly, I used some different and more varied leaf shapes in this one. A few days after drawing this I actually did a leaf study which was a lot of fun. But it’s the large slash of negative space down the right side of the image that I love the most here. Negative space in images can be a very powerful took to use and create amazing illusions and tricks of the eye in pieces.

This particular negative space inclusion was essentially an accident. I had drawn the plants around the top of the eye and had that one space between the leaves and the little daisy type flowers and had no idea what to draw there. So I just left it blank, and let that space bleed down into the eyeball. I think it was super effective and turned out great!

A New Pen Enters the Chat…

I’ve talked at length about the main pens I use in my art, the Tombow Fudenosuke brush pens. There is another tool that I enjoy using which I’ve recently brought back into rotation though. The Staedtler Pigment Liner.

My history with this pen is a pretty simple one. I read once that Mike Mignola (creator of Hellboy and my personal all time favourite artist) uses them. And I figure if they’re good enough for the master, they’re good enough for me!

Staedtler Pigment Liners

They’re a felt tip style fine liner that goes all the way down to .05 in size. I generally use .1 and .05 for really find crosshatching and texturing details where the brush pens are just too chonky to get the fineness of line that I’d like.
